Output 81e532894d0f753f2779f4b370f2a61e0758e88c1c4cadbec4af20379b581895:0

value
489114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abc0409015a7ec80749c3bb983b450a945502a3 OP_EQUAL
address
3P6BGzjghXkzpWcaBrsANcw6jsRFVxbEbG
transaction
81e532894d0f753f2779f4b370f2a61e0758e88c1c4cadbec4af20379b581895
spent
true